Pacific Gas & Electric Company has historically focused its management commentary on operational reliability, safety improvements, and infrastructure modernization across its extensive service territory. The utility has emphasized its commitment to reducing wildfire risks through enhanced vegetation management programs, grid hardening initiatives, and advanced monitoring technologies. Management has consistently highlighted the importance of regulatory relationships with the California Public Utilities Commission, which oversees rate adjustments and capital investment approvals that directly impact the company's financial flexibility and ability to service its preferred dividend obligations. The company's approach to preferred stockholder communications has centered on maintaining stable dividend payments and demonstrating the financial resilience of its regulated utility business model, which benefits from relatively predictable revenue streams derived from CPUC-approved rate structures. Pacific Gas & Electric Co. preferred stockholders should consider several key factors when evaluating the security's outlook. The utility operates in a challenging regulatory and operational environment characterized by increasing climate-related risks, particularly wildfire exposure across its service territory. These factors could potentially influence the company's long-term financial stability and its capacity to meet preferred dividend obligations. Preferred stockholders might benefit from monitoring developments in California's utility regulatory framework, including potential changes to wildfire cost allocation mechanisms and the state's broader energy policy direction. The utility's ongoing capital expenditure requirements for infrastructure modernization and safety improvements represent both operational necessities and potential pressure points on financial flexibility. Credit rating agency assessments of Pacific's debt obligations provide useful indicators of the overall financial health that supports preferred stock dividends. Investors may wish to track any shifts in the utility's credit outlook, as improved financial stability could benefit preferred stockholders while deterioration could signal increased risk to dividend continuity. Trading activity in PCG^D reflects broader market conditions for utility-sector preferred stocks and investor sentiment toward California utilities specifically. The 5% coupon represents a meaningful yield component for income-oriented portfolios, though investors should evaluate the security's risk-return profile relative to alternative fixed-income investments. Market participants assessing Pacific's preferred stock likely consider factors including interest rate sensitivity, credit quality implications from wildfire-related liabilities, and the regulatory environment's potential impact on the utility's earnings capacity. The first redemption feature of this preferred issue also introduces timing considerations, as the company retains the option to call the securities at predetermined prices. Analysts covering the utility sector have observed increased investor focus on operational risk management within California's utility landscape. Pacific's safety initiatives and regulatory compliance record represent key metrics that the investment community monitors when evaluating the creditworthiness supporting preferred dividend payments. The broader preferred stock market has experienced periodic volatility tied to interest rate expectations and credit market conditions. Pacific's preferred securities trade alongside other utility preferred issues, and sector-wide trends in yield spreads and demand patterns may influence valuation levels for PCG^D.
